Output aedaac56f260cd4dd12d967a018ac61b20a4525928491e51fa9c63051ac5bb39:1

value
87619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fe2ad5022631c0c1c7c325b3c4f506fc9e26a9c OP_EQUAL
address
38yQrVXioiNWGhQiLjVEfX6aXAD9LYbcJH
transaction
aedaac56f260cd4dd12d967a018ac61b20a4525928491e51fa9c63051ac5bb39
confirmations
117563
spent
true